NAME¶
Bot::BasicBot::Pluggable::Module::ChanOp - Channel operator
SYNOPSIS¶
msg> me: !op #botzone
msg> bot: Okay, i +o you in #botzone
msg> me: !kick #botzone malice Stay outta here!
msg> bot: Okay, i kicked malice from #botzone
msg> me: !deop #botzone
msg> bot: Okay, i -o you in #botzone
DESCRIPTION¶
This module provides commands to perform basic channel management functions with
the help of your bot instance. You can op and deop yourself any time, ask your
bot to kick malicious users. It also provides a flood control mechanism, that
will kick any user who send more than a specified amount of mesasges in a
given time.
VARIABLES¶
user_auto_op¶
If true, it will op any user who joins a channel and is already authenticated by
your bot. Defaults to false.
user_flood_control¶
If true, every user who sends more than
"user_flood_messages" in
"user_flood_seconds" will be kicked from the
channel. Defaults to false.
user_flood_messages¶
Maximum numbers of messages per user in
"user_flood_seconds". Defaults to 6.
